Cookies In Air Fryer Without Parchment Paper

Nowadays, there is many brands selling parchment paper that fits the size of your air fryer. I have tried it and not liked cooking with it. But there is limited parchment paper where I live, so maybe I just need to find the right brand.

Anyway, this has resulted with me either putting cookies directly in the air fryer basket (which creates a LOT of mess) or coming up with a plan B.

My quick plan B is to use foil instead of parchment paper. You can place it into the air fryer basket and then sit your cookies on it. Then remove the foil and cookies from the air fryer together once cooked, and the foil then becomes your cooling tray. You can also eat your cookies from the foil to save on washing up.

Here are my oatmeal cookies using some foil:

Cookies In Air Fryer Without Parchment Paper

The slow plan B is to buy a reusable silicone baking sheet, and have it cut to size for the air fryer you are using. This is fantastic because it wipes clean and is better for the environment compared to using new foil each time you make air fryer cookies.

Oatmeal Cookies In Air Fryer Ingredients

Oatmeal Cookies In Air Frye

Oats – The most memorable ingredient in oatmeal cookies is the rolled oats. They give that amazing crunch to your cookies and have you going back for seconds. Any rolled oats are fine, but I prefer this brand.

Butter – Any butter will do and get it out of the fridge an hour before baking, that way it will be easier for you to rub your butter into your flour.

Flour. I recommend that you use self raising flour as it will make your oatmeal cookies puffed up and they wont feel flat.

Sugar. For the sweetener you can use whatever you prefer. Though I use caster sugar because it provides the best results in baking. I also like to add golden syrup and vanilla essence for extra flavour.

How To Bake Air Fryer Oatmeal Cookies?

oatmeal cookies in air fryer
  • Prep. Load into a mixing bowl flour, sugar, and butter. Chop the butter into small bite sized chunks as it will be easier to prep your cookies. Then using your fingertips rub the fat into the flour and sugar until it resembles coarse breadcrumbs.
  • Oats. Then add in the rolled oats and your other ingredients and mix well. You can also add in chocolate chips now, or raisins now, if you are including them in your oatmeal cookies.
  • Milk. Next add a little mix at a time and mix with your hands until you have cookie dough. Note that because of the golden syrup and the vanilla essence, you only need a tiny bit of milk to make a dough.
  • Air Fry. Load the oatmeal cookies into the air fryer, and air fry for approximately 11 minutes. Allow to cool before serving.

Are Oatmeal Cookies Unhealthy?

Oatmeal cookies are healthier than traditional chocolate chip cookies but I still wouldn’t consider them to be healthy. That is because they still feature butter, sugar and flour.

However, because you are using gluten free healthy rolled oats in this recipe, you are reducing the quantity of flour, making it slightly healthier than classic cookies.

Why Are My Oatmeal Cookies Dry?

There are two reasons for dry oatmeal cookies. Either you have cooked your cookies for too long, or there is not enough liquid in the dough.

This can be solved next time by slightly reducing the cook time and adding in extra vanilla essence and a little extra milk to your next batch.

Instructions

  • Place flour and sugar in a bowl and mix. Add in cubed butter. Rub the fat into the flour. Do this with your fingertips until it resembles coarse breadcrumbs. Stir in oats and add everything else but the milk.
    How To Bake Air Fryer Oatmeal Cookies?
  • Stir well with your hands and then add a little milk to make your mixture into a large dough ball.
    How To Bake Air Fryer Oatmeal Cookies?
  • Roll out on a floured worktop with your rolling pin and use cookie cutters and cut to a medium size. Or cut smaller if you plan to make crème pies. Place a layer of foil in your air fryer and add oatmeal cookies in one layer, making sure they are not touching each other.
    How To Bake Air Fryer Oatmeal Cookies?
  • Air fry for 8 minutes at 180c/360f followed by a further 3 minutes at 160c/320f. Allow to cool slightly and then serve with milk.
    How To Bake Air Fryer Oatmeal Cookies?

Notes

Pies. If you would like to make oatmeal crème pies then I recommend you go two sizes down on your cookie cutter and then air fry for 5 minutes at 180c followed by 2 minutes at 160c. Then allow them to cool a little before adding cream to one and sticking them together.
